📜  将 jar 文件放入 maven - Java (1)

📅  最后修改于: 2023-12-03 14:53:43.705000             🧑  作者: Mango

将 jar 文件放入 Maven - Java

在Java开发中,Maven是一个流行的构建工具和项目管理工具。它可以帮助我们管理项目依赖、构建过程和部署等任务。当我们需要使用第三方库或依赖时,通常会将jar文件添加到Maven项目中。本文将介绍如何将jar文件放入Maven项目中。

1. 下载jar文件

首先,我们需要从可信的资源下载所需的jar文件。你可以通过访问第三方库的官方网站、GitHub或Maven仓库等来获取jar文件。确保下载与你项目需求一致的版本。

2. 将jar文件添加到Maven仓库

Maven使用仓库(Repository)来管理项目的依赖项。我们可以将jar文件添加到本地Maven仓库,以便在项目中引用。

步骤:
  1. 打开命令行工具,进入jar文件所在的目录。
  2. 运行以下命令将jar文件添加到Maven仓库:
mvn install:install-file -Dfile=<path-to-jar-file> -DgroupId=<group-id> -DartifactId=<artifact-id> -Dversion=<version> -Dpackaging=<packaging>
  • <path-to-jar-file>:jar文件的路径。
  • <group-id>:组织的唯一标识符,通常使用Java反转的域名,例如:com.example。
  • <artifact-id>:项目或模块的唯一标识符,通常是项目的名称。
  • <version>:jar文件的版本号。
  • <packaging>:jar文件的打包类型,通常为"jar"。

例如,如果要将一个名为"example.jar"的jar文件添加到Maven仓库,可以运行以下命令:

mvn install:install-file -Dfile=example.jar -DgroupId=com.example -DartifactId=example -Dversion=1.0.0 -Dpackaging=jar
  1. Maven会将jar文件添加到本地仓库(默认为用户目录下的.m2目录)中。
3. 在Maven项目中引用jar文件

一旦jar文件添加到了Maven仓库,我们就可以在项目的pom.xml文件中引用它。

步骤:
  1. 打开Maven项目的pom.xml文件。
  2. <dependencies>标签内添加以下代码:
<dependency>
    <groupId>com.example</groupId>
    <artifactId>example</artifactId>
    <version>1.0.0</version>
</dependency>
  • <groupId>:jar文件的组织标识符,与添加jar文件到仓库时使用的相同。
  • <artifactId>:jar文件的唯一标识符,与添加jar文件到仓库时使用的相同。
  • <version>:jar文件的版本号,与添加jar文件到仓库时使用的相同。
  1. 保存pom.xml文件,Maven将会下载并自动管理所需的jar文件。
总结

通过上述步骤,我们可以将jar文件放入Maven项目中,并通过添加依赖的方式在项目中引用它。这样,我们就能更加方便地管理和使用第三方库或依赖,提高代码复用性和可维护性。

希望本文对你理解如何将jar文件放入Maven项目有所帮助!